im通讯接口在数据传输过程中如何防止恶意攻击?
随着互联网技术的飞速发展,IM通讯接口已成为人们日常生活中不可或缺的一部分。然而,在数据传输过程中,恶意攻击事件也层出不穷。如何防止恶意攻击,保障IM通讯接口的安全,成为了一个亟待解决的问题。本文将从以下几个方面展开讨论。
一、加强身份认证
采用强密码策略:要求用户设置复杂密码,定期更换密码,提高密码强度。
多因素认证:结合密码、短信验证码、动态令牌等多种认证方式,提高认证安全性。
二维码认证:用户扫描二维码进行认证,有效防止恶意攻击者通过盗取密码等方式入侵账户。
二、加密传输
SSL/TLS协议:采用SSL/TLS协议对IM通讯数据进行加密传输,防止数据在传输过程中被窃取或篡改。
数据加密算法:选用先进的加密算法,如AES、RSA等,对数据进行加密处理。
通信加密:对IM通讯接口进行通信加密,确保数据在传输过程中的安全性。
三、安全协议与机制
安全套接字层(SSL):在IM通讯接口中使用SSL协议,实现端到端加密,防止数据在传输过程中被窃取。
安全多用途互联网邮件扩展(S/MIME):采用S/MIME协议对IM通讯数据进行加密和签名,确保数据完整性和真实性。
数据包过滤:对IM通讯接口进行数据包过滤,拦截恶意数据包,防止恶意攻击。
四、实时监控与预警
实时监控:对IM通讯接口进行实时监控,及时发现异常行为,如大量登录失败、频繁发送垃圾信息等。
预警机制:建立预警机制,当发现异常行为时,及时通知用户采取措施,防止恶意攻击。
安全审计:对IM通讯接口进行安全审计,分析攻击手段,提高防御能力。
五、安全教育与培训
加强安全意识:提高用户对IM通讯接口安全问题的认识,引导用户养成良好的安全习惯。
安全培训:定期对员工进行安全培训,提高员工的安全意识和应对能力。
案例分析:通过分析真实案例,让用户了解恶意攻击的手段和危害,提高防范意识。
六、应急响应与处理
建立应急响应机制:当发现恶意攻击时,迅速启动应急响应机制,采取有效措施应对。
处理流程:明确恶意攻击处理流程,确保问题得到及时解决。
恢复措施:在恶意攻击事件发生后,采取有效措施恢复系统正常运行,降低损失。
总之,在IM通讯接口数据传输过程中,防止恶意攻击需要从多个方面入手。通过加强身份认证、加密传输、安全协议与机制、实时监控与预警、安全教育与培训以及应急响应与处理等措施,可以有效提高IM通讯接口的安全性,保障用户数据安全。
猜你喜欢:语聊房